N2 - An enthalpimetric determination of urea using immobilized urease in a flow system is described. Sensitivity of analysis is related to the mole reaction enthalpy (dHR). This is estimated as (61 ±3 kJ mol−1 and 20 ±1 kJ mol−1 in sodium phosphate and tris-HCl buffer respectively. Factors affecting the minimum amount of urea detected, linearity range and rate of analysis are discussed.
